Skip to content
Permalink
Browse files

Remove deprecated use of script_files (#728)

* Remove deprecated use of script_files

Fixes sphinx-doc/sphinx#6088

* Add script block

* Fix build error
  • Loading branch information...
Blendify committed Apr 3, 2019
1 parent ddfdd35 commit a49a812c8821123091166fae1897d702cdc2d627
Showing with 6 additions and 1 deletion.
  1. +2 −0 sphinx_rtd_theme/layout.html
  2. +4 −1 sphinx_rtd_theme/search.html
@@ -29,6 +29,7 @@
{% endif %}

{# JAVASCRIPTS #}
{%- block scripts %}
<script type="text/javascript" src="{{ pathto('_static/js/modernizr.min.js', 1) }}"></script>
{%- if not embedded %}
{# XXX Sphinx 1.8.0 made this an external js-file, quick fix until we refactor the template to inherert more blocks directly from sphinx #}
@@ -62,6 +63,7 @@
href="{{ pathto('_static/opensearch.xml', 1) }}"/>
{%- endif %}
{%- endif %}
{%- endblock %}

{# CSS #}
<link rel="stylesheet" href="{{ pathto('_static/' + style, 1) }}" type="text/css" />
@@ -9,7 +9,10 @@
#}
{%- extends "layout.html" %}
{% set title = _('Search') %}
{% set script_files = script_files + ['_static/searchtools.js'] %}
{%- block scripts %}
{{ super() }}
<script type="text/javascript" src="{{ pathto('_static/searchtools.js', 1) }}"></script>
{%- endblock %}
{% block footer %}
<script type="text/javascript">
jQuery(function() { Search.loadIndex("{{ pathto('searchindex.js', 1) }}"); });

0 comments on commit a49a812

Please sign in to comment.
You can’t perform that action at this time.